What's The Definition Of Great auk?
[n] large large flightless auk of rocky islands off North Atlantic coast; extinct
Synonyms | Synonyms for Great auk: Pinguinus impennis Related Terms | Find terms related to Great auk: See Also | auk | genus Pinguinus | Pinguinus |
